Is Syracuse, Utah a good place to live?
Syracuse is a city in Utah state in USA with a population of 30366 residents.. The poverty rate of Syracuse is 5.8%, which is 59% lower than national average. The typical household in Syracuse earns $103522 a year, compared to the national median of $67,500. Nearly 12.7% of households earn less than $50,000 a year compared to 39% national rate.

A high school education is a basic prerequisite for most jobs, and in Syracuse, only 97% of adults have a high school diploma, compared to the 87.7% of adults nationwide. The unemployment rate of Syracuse remained 1.4%, which is 70% lower than national rate. Higher educational attainment can lead to improved job security and reduce the likelihood of financial insecurity. In Syracuse, only 35% of adults have a bachelor's degree and 41% have some college but no degree.

Cost of living in Syracuse is 111, which is 11% higher than national average. Median home value in Syracuse is $340900 , which is 48% higher than national average. While median income in Syracuse remained $103522, which is 53% higher than national average. Is Syracuse, Utah safe place to live?
The overall crime rate in Syracuse, Utah is 66% lower than national average. The violent crime rate of Syracuse is 81% lower than national average. While the property crime rate of Syracuse is 63% lower than national average. You have 1 in 1265 chance of being victim of violent crime. You have 1 in 131 chance of being victim of property crime.
